Fondazione Querini Stampalia
The Fondazione Querini Stampalia is a cultural institution in Venice, Italy, founded in 1869 at the behest of Conte Giovanni (Count John), the last descendant of the Venetian Querini Stampalia family.Architect Carlo Scarpa designed interior, exterior, and garden elements and spaces on the ground floor of the historic building.
